Output 105cb37c4690b4d374339250f9c5fde040d25b4709d8c937e4992f6159b7aad9:55

value
641604
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d86a38042406000a71ee34a18937e2c30429e80 OP_EQUAL
address
3D8jgP6UV3WfyP2ZGqYWJpsbaPdzZr1FuN
transaction
105cb37c4690b4d374339250f9c5fde040d25b4709d8c937e4992f6159b7aad9
spent
true